问题标签 [imread]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1533 浏览

octave - 已禁用对图像 IO 的 Octave imread 支持

我正在尝试使用 octave 3.8 读取图像。我通过下载代码并在我的系统上制作来安装 octave。

我用了imread("oct.png")

并得到了这个错误

错误:imread:无效的图像文件:imfinfo:在构建 Octave 时禁用了对图像 IO 的支持

请帮忙。

PS我使用以下命令构建:

提前致谢!

0 投票
2 回答
208 浏览

c++ - sprintf - 字符串前 4 个无用的 ascii 字符

我正在使用visual studio 10、qt addin 和opecv 库。

我想要做的是使用for循环加载多个文件:

(我有 ui.image_templates_comboBox->currentText() = "cat")

所以,我认为这应该可以正常工作,但是当我调试它时,我将鼠标悬停在“名称”上方,我注意到 currentText 值之前有 4 个非英文字符。

我问2个问题:

a) 怎么可能省略这 4 个无用的字符?(我将它们输入为“1234”,因为此站点无法显示它们)

  • 名称 0x003a7b04 "Logos/cat/1234cat_1.tif" 字符 [40]

b) 可以使用 imread() 中的表达式将这 4 行折叠为 1 行吗?

0 投票
1 回答
605 浏览

python - pip install imread 在 Microsoft Visual 步骤中失败

我正在尝试安装 imread 来进行一些图像分析。我正在运行 2.7.9。当我在 powershell 中键入 pip install imread 时,程序会一直运行,直到它遇到 Microsoft Visual C++ 中的一些片段。我附上了一张图片,显示了障碍在哪里。请帮忙。 http://imgur.com/ZcMMk28

0 投票
1 回答
509 浏览

scilab - 读取 Scilab 文件夹中的多个图像

我想读取 Scilab 文件夹中的多个图像。我的代码是:

但它不起作用。它显示错误“无效索引”。

0 投票
2 回答
1776 浏览

c++ - imread 找不到图片

我使用视觉工作室 2013 和 opencv。我运行一个简单的代码来读取图像并显示它。我将图像从 Donloads 文件添加到我的项目的资源文件中。当我在下面运行代码时,image.data它是空的。

}

0 投票
0 回答
2032 浏览

c++ - OpenCV resize() 断言失败

我在使用 OpenCV 时遇到问题,并且断言失败错误。读取图像似乎有问题,因此函数imread()静默失败,然后在resize()函数中崩溃,因为输入图像为空。

我检查了路径,没关系,事实上,如果我打印我试图读取的路径并在终端图像中打开路径打开就好了。此外,如果我采用我打印的这条路径并将其放入字符串变量代码中。所以问题似乎出在ss对象上。我只是不知道是什么。

这是我的代码:

运行这个:

我在堆栈中发现这个链接有类似的问题,但答案只是一段代码,可以知道图像是否被正确读取(上面的注释代码)。我知道我的不是,但路径还可以。

0 投票
2 回答
7863 浏览

c++ - Opencv imread 不适用于相对路径

正如标题所说。我尝试使用 argv 和绝对路径加载图像并且它有效,但使用相对路径却没有。该图像位于可执行文件的同一目录中。我在 Windows 7 64 位上使用 Visual Studio 2013 和 opencv 2.4.10。我该如何解决?

编辑

这是我的代码:

我也尝试使用“./”“/”“//”“\”和“\”,但它仍然无法正常工作!

0 投票
0 回答
106 浏览

matlab - 使用内存地址作为输入

我有一堆图像在内存中。我想使用这些图像的地址作为输入,所以我可以将它们加载到 matlab 中。我知道如果我不使用内存地址作为输入,我可以使用 imread。

我怎样才能做到这一点?

0 投票
1 回答
641 浏览

matlab - 在matlab中保存一个int16堆叠的tif

我正在尝试在 matlab 中保存一个 .tif。imwrite 不支持直接为 .tif 写 int16,但是可以将我的图片投到 uint16 并使用 imwrite。

当我这样做时,对比度似乎以某种方式增加,而我希望图片是相同的。

其次,我尝试使用如下

我在这里有同样的问题,对比度上升,它破坏了画面。我正在处理灰度的图片。有没有办法保存这些图片而不破坏它?

0 投票
2 回答
5577 浏览

c++ - imread 无法读取图像

我一直在从事一个检测离线手写签名的项目。我遇到了一个基本问题。我的程序无法使用imread()功能。它没有显示任何错误,但也没有加载图像。如果我检查图像,它会显示我指定的错误消息。我将 OpenCV 2.4.10 与 Microsoft Visual C++ 2010 一起使用,并且我使用的是 Windows 8。

这是我配置 OpenCV 方式的问题还是版本有问题?

我该如何克服这个问题?

如果您有任何完美的使用 Microsoft Visual C++ 配置 OpenCV 的教程,请与我分享。这是我正在运行的代码。而且,在运行时,输出对话框显示Native' has exited with code -1。现在我看不到消息“错误:无法加载图像..!! ”。但问题仍然没有解决。